在使用Pandas进行数据处理时,`resample`方法能够帮助我们重新采样时间序列数据,从而计算出每个月的平均值。为了让你能够顺利完成第5步,请看下面的示例代码:
import pandas as pd
# 假设你已经有一个DataFrame df,其中包含一个时间序列列 'date_column' 和一个需要计算均值的列 'value_column'
# 将 'date_column' 转换为 datetime 类型
df['date_column'] = pd.to_datetime(df['date_column'])
# 设置 'date_column' 为索引
df.set_index('date_column', inplace=True)
# 按月重采样,并计算每个月的 'value_column' 平均值
monthly_average = df['value_column'].resample('M').mean()
# 打印结果
print(monthly_average)
在这个示例中,`'date_column'`应该替换为你的DataFrame中表示日期的列名,`'value_column'`替换为你想要求平均值的列名。这段代码将帮助你计算每个月的平均值。
使用 `resample('M')` 可以按月重采样你的数据,然后 `mean()` 用于计算每个月的平均值。Hope this helps you move forward with your code!
以上回复来自 FishC AI 小助理,如未能正确解答您的问题,请继续追问。 |